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,333,094,066
Lastest Block:
1,976,553
Utxos:
1,984,759
Nodes:
351
OmniXEP Contracts:
274
Block details
[STAKE]
30/12/2025 16:04:00 UTC
Txid
0cfd7c3b87bb7348d01a3165b5542c73b033d7d7e4515edc4257df239cb2d054
Block
1,976,202
Block hash
371103b4d675026db41a5e639dbc3e394189de7dd7f6267461a77ed2ca691d2e
Stake amount
1,283.42637351 XEP
Sender
ep1qrup4ayvrrl4d4kcj5sravvcewmj5ekpqxgz0me
Recipient
ep1qrup4ayvrrl4d4kcj5sravvcewmj5ekpqxgz0me
(522,129.83251198 XEP)